Electrolyser Stack OEM Integration in South Africa’s Hydrogen Market

South Africa's Hydrogen Society Roadmap envisions a "Hydrogen Valley" corridor connecting Johannesburg to Durban. The country's platinum group metals (PGM) mining industry creates natural synergies with fuel cell and electrolyser technology. Rich solar and wind resources support green hydrogen production.

IONZERA supports South Africa's Hydrogen Valley vision with efficient AWE membranes that reduce hydrogen production costs for mining, industrial, and transport applications.

Area Resistance

3x LOWER
Area Specific Resistance ComparisonIONZERA0.09-0.1 Ω·cm²Zirfon0.30 Ω·cm²00.10.20.3 Ω·cm²~3x Lower

Thickness

20% THINNER
Membrane Thickness ComparisonIONZERA350-410 μmZirfon500 μm500 μm scale20-30%thinnerThinner membrane = More compact stacks= Higher power density
